Blake Garlock
Blake Garlock is North American Whitetail’s Managing Editor and co-host of North American Whitetail TV. Blake has traveled the continent in pursuit of whitetails, earning experience hunting America’s deer in nearly every habitat they reside in. Blake has hunted and taken mature bucks on public land, private land and with archery and firearms equipment. He’s eager to share his knowledge with entry-level deer hunters so they too can experience whitetail success.